About Fried fish head

Fried fish head is a flavorful dish popular in various cuisines, such as Southeast Asian, Caribbean, and Indian. Typically made by frying the head of a fish like snapper, salmon, or grouper, it is often seasoned with a blend of spices, herbs, and marinades. Rich in protein and omega-3 fatty acids, fried fish head provides essential nutrients that support heart health, brain function, and muscle repair. The dish is also a source of calcium and phosphorus, thanks to the small, edible bones and cartilage. However, frying adds significant fat content, particularly if cooked in oil high in saturated or trans fats. Moderation is key to balancing its nutritional benefits with its higher calorie and cholesterol levels. Fried fish head is a culinary delight that combines crispy textures and rich, savory flavors, making it a cherished comfort food in many cultures.
